B2Metric is an AI-based predictive analytics solution that helps businesses analyze and predict user behavior across multiple channels. It offers data integration, predictive analytics, and machine learning to enable informed decision-making.

To use B2Metric, start by integrating your data sources with the platform, including data warehouses, advertising tools, CRM platforms, and marketing tools. Once integrated, B2Metric provides customizable and user-friendly dashboards for your teams to gain insights and make data-driven decisions. You can track user behavior, analyze customer churn patterns, optimize marketing efforts, detect anomalies, and improve user experiences. The platform also offers predictive analytics and custom dashboards to share insights with colleagues.
B2Metric offers quick and seamless integration with data warehouses, advertising tools, CRM platforms, customer data platforms, and marketing tools.
B2Metric provides targeted customer analysis and optimization of marketing strategies. It allows you to track and compare data from multiple channels and campaigns, analyze user journeys, and uncover insights and patterns for improved campaign efficiency and business growth.
